The Diagnostic Revolution: Unprecedented Accuracy and Speed
One area where artificial intelligence is already making a significant impact is disease diagnosis.
Medical Image Processing
Advanced Deep Learning algorithms can analyze X-ray, CT, MRI, and ultrasound images with a level of accuracy that competes with – and sometimes exceeds – that of experienced radiologists. The significant advantage is the ability to process vast amounts of images quickly, reduce human error, and identify complex patterns that might be missed by the human eye.
Early Disease Detection
AI systems enable early detection of medical conditions such as cancer, heart disease, and diabetes, sometimes years before symptoms appear. For example, algorithms analyzing routine eye exams can identify early signs of diseases such as Alzheimer's, diabetes, and vascular diseases.
Personalized Medicine: The Right Treatment for the Right Person
Artificial intelligence enables a precise and personalized approach to medical treatment, based on medical history, genetic information, and even lifestyle data.
Genomic Medicine
AI systems analyze complex genomic data and identify mutations and risk factors, enabling prevention and intervention programs tailored to each patient's genetic profile. This approach is especially helpful in oncology, where treatments can be tailored to the specific genetic structure of the tumor.
Drug Dosage Optimization
Smart algorithms adjust drug dosages based on data such as age, weight, kidney and liver function, and history of drug responses. This process increases treatment effectiveness and reduces side effects.
Medical Information Management: From Data to Insights
The healthcare system generates enormous amounts of data every day. Artificial intelligence can turn this information into a valuable resource.
Smart Electronic Medical Records
AI systems help organize, analyze, and access medical information, enabling doctors to make more informed decisions and dedicate more quality time to patients. Algorithms can also identify patterns and alert to dangerous drug interactions or unidentified allergies.
Medical Research and Drug Discovery
Artificial intelligence accelerates the drug discovery process, shortens development time, and reduces costs. Algorithms can scan millions of chemical compounds and identify potential candidates for drug development, as well as predict possible side effects.
Digital Health Services: Making Medicine Accessible
Artificial intelligence expands access to health services, especially in remote areas or those with a shortage of medical resources.
Medical Bots and Virtual Assistance
AI-based virtual assistants can provide basic medical information, assist in managing chronic diseases, and help patients decide if they need immediate medical care. They also help manage medication reminders, monitor vital signs, and track treatments.
Advanced Telemedicine
Telemedicine platforms integrated with AI can analyze real-time data from wearable devices and home sensors, process images sent by the patient, and even identify microscopic changes in voice tone or facial expressions that might indicate a medical condition.
Challenges and Ethical Questions
Despite impressive progress, integrating AI in medicine raises a series of challenges and ethical questions:
- Privacy and Data Security: How do we protect sensitive medical information in an era of massive data analysis?
- Liability Issues: Who bears responsibility in case of an error in diagnosis or treatment made by an AI system?
- Biases and Inequality: How do we ensure that medical AI systems don't replicate or exacerbate existing biases in the healthcare system?
- Professional Training: How do we train the next generation of medical professionals to work in collaboration with AI systems?
